CVE-2022-34009
Fossil 2.18 on Windows allows attackers to cause a denial of service daemon crash via an XSS payload in a ticket. This occurs because the ticket data is stored in a temporary file, and the product does not properly handle the absence of this file after Windows Defender has flagged it as malware...
